Output 43c325de47ec14c3ed8bc9e24eba893a84f29b342dd6fabb7583b741a915a26d:34

value
3066923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65a1c51a6815226babb61c9b1d1f9e7e0e14bc0d OP_EQUAL
address
3AxPxtcaXUFr1MBmaKT9asg4TvucWYdH2o
transaction
43c325de47ec14c3ed8bc9e24eba893a84f29b342dd6fabb7583b741a915a26d
spent
true